The Big Enchilada: How Much Does Car Insurance REALLY Cost?
Here's the thing: there's no one-size-fits-all answer. Car insurance is like a pick-your-own-adventure novel – the price depends on a bunch of factors, from your driving record (hopefully squeaky clean) to your zip code (city slickers tend to pay more than country bumpkins).

But fear not, intrepid driver! Here's a ballpark figure to get you started:
- Minimum Coverage: This is the bare minimum required by law (think liability to cover someone else's stuff if you mess up). In Pennsylvania, you're looking at around $380 a year, which is like, a few fancy cheesesteaks.
- Full Coverage: This is where things get fancy, with coverage for your own car on top of liability. Here, the average Pennsylvanian pays around $1,014 a year.

You got it, eagle eye! Here's a quick rundown of the sneaky little things that can affect your car insurance rate:
- Your Age: Teenagers? Buckle up for higher rates (sorry, gotta pay your dues!).
- Your Driving Record: Got a lead foot or a magnet for accidents? Brace yourself for a pricier policy.
- Your Car: Insuring a flashy sports car will cost more than your grandma's sensible sedan.
- Your Credit Score: Believe it or not, a good credit score can snag you a discount!

Now we're talking! Here are a few battle-tested tips:
- Shop Around: Don't just settle for the first quote you get! Get quotes from multiple companies to find the best deal.
- Consider Usage-Based Insurance: If you're a low-mileage driver, this type of insurance rewards safe driving habits and can save you some serious cash.
- Bundle Your Insurance: Insuring your car and home with the same company can often score you a discount.
- Increase Your Deductible: A higher deductible means you'll pay more out of pocket if you need to file a claim, but it also lowers your monthly premium. Just make sure you can actually afford the deductible if something happens!
